Commercial Land Preparation in Marietta, GA
Commercial land preparation services involve clearing, grading, and leveling property to ready it for construction or development projects. This process often includes removing existing vegetation, debris, or structures, as well as ensuring proper drainage and a stable foundation. Projects can range from preparing a site for new retail centers and office buildings to setting the groundwork for industrial facilities or large-scale landscaping projects. Property owners typically want to understand how the land will be made suitable for their intended use, including details about soil stability, drainage solutions, and any necessary site modifications.
Before requesting land preparation services, property owners should consider the current condition of the land and any specific requirements for their project. It is helpful to know the size of the area, the presence of any obstacles such as rocks or old structures, and whether permits or regulations might influence the work. Clarifying these details can ensure that the site is properly prepared to support construction activities and meet local standards.

Common Commercial Land Preparation Jobs
Site Clearing - removing trees, brush, and debris to prepare land for development or landscaping.
Grading and Leveling - shaping the land to create a stable, even surface for construction or landscaping projects.
Soil Testing and Preparation - assessing soil quality and improving it to support future structures or plantings.
Drainage Installation - designing and installing systems to manage water flow and prevent flooding on the property.
Excavation Services - digging trenches and foundations needed for building projects or utility installs.
Vegetation Removal - clearing unwanted plants and roots to create a clean, build-ready site.
Commercial Land Preparation Questions
What does commercial land preparation include? It involves clearing, grading, and leveling the land to create a suitable foundation for construction or development projects.
Why is land preparation important before building? Proper preparation ensures stability, proper drainage, and a solid base, reducing future issues during construction.
How is land cleared for commercial projects? Land clearing typically involves removing trees, brush, rocks, and existing structures to create a clean workspace.
What should property owners consider before starting land preparation? It's important to assess the land’s topography, soil condition, and any permits or regulations that may apply to development plans.
